Police are growing increasingly concerned for a 16-year-old girl who has not been seen for nine days, after leaving her friend’s house.

Charmaine Wilkinson, from Coulsdon, was last seen at her home at about 7.30pm on January 3 before she went to stay with a friend.

She then left the friend’s house and has not been seen or made contact with anyone since.

Charmaine is white, 5ft 5in, of a slim build with long brown hair.

When she was last seen she was wearing black leggings, a jumper or hooded top, pink and black Nike Air Max trainers and fluffy socks.

She spends time in Croydon, Purley, Thornton Heath and the surrounding areas and Surrey officers are working with the Metropolitan Police to try and establish her whereabouts.

PC Ian Matthews, from the Surrey Police missing persons team, said: "We are all very concerned for Charmaine's welfare, particularly as she has not responded to any messages through email or Facebook and her phone also appears to be switched off.

"We would just like to speak to her so that we know she is safe and well.

"Please call us straightaway if you have any information which could assist our enquiries."
